What types of mixtures are these? (Homogeneous Mixture Hetergeneous Mixture)

Explanation: A <u>homogeneous mixture</u> is a solid, liquid, or gaseous mixture that has the same proportions of its components throughout any given sample. The components that make them up are evenly distributed and the appearance of the solution is uniform throughout.

A<u> heterogeneous mixture</u> has components whose proportions vary throughout the sample. The components of a heterogeneous mixture are visible and not uniform throughout. A heterogeneous mixture is simply any mixture that is not uniform in composition.

a) Peanuts and almonds mixed  together in a bowl  : The components(Peanuts and almonds) are visible in a bowl and are not evenly distributed and also not uniform throughout. So this is a 'heterogeneous mixture'.

b) Bucket full of sand and gravel  : The components(sand and gravel) are visible in a bucket and are not evenly distributed and also not uniform throughout. So this is a 'heterogeneous mixture'.

c) Cup of tea and sugar  : The components(tea and sugar) are evenly distributed and the appearance of the solution is uniform throughout. So this is a 'Homogeneous mixture'.

d) Food coloring dissolved in water : The components(Food coloring and water) are evenly distributed and the appearance of the solution is uniform throughout. So this is a 'Homogeneous mixture'.

A chemistry student needs to standardize a fresh solution of sodium hydroxide. She carefully weighs out 385.mg of oxalic acid H2
Vlada [557]

Answer:

The molarity of the sodium hydroxide solution is 0.0692 M

Explanation:

<u>Step 1: </u>Data given

Mass of H2C2O4 = 385 mg = 0.385 grams

volume = 250 mL = 0.250 L

Volume of NaOH = 123.7 mL = 0.1237 L

Molar mass H2C2O4 = 90.03 g/mol

<u>Step 2</u>: The balanced equation

2NaOH + H2C2O4 → Na2C2O4 + 2H2O

<u>Step 3:</u> Calculate moles H2C2O4

Moles H2C2O4 = mass H2C2O4 / molar mass H2C2O4

Moles H2C2O4 = 0.385 grams / 90.03 g/mol

Moles H2C2O4 = 0.00428 moles

<u>Step 4: </u>Calculate molarity of H2C2O4

Molarity H2C2O4 = moles / volume

Molarity H2C2O4 = 0.00428 moles / 0.250 L

Molarity H2C2O4 = 0.01712 M

<u>Step 5:</u> Calculate molarity of NaOH

2*Ca*Va = n*Cb*Vb

⇒ with Ca = Molarity of H2C2O4 = 0.01712 M

⇒ Va = volume of H2C2O4 = 0.250 L

⇒Cb = molarity of NaOH = TO BE DETERMINED

⇒ Vb = volume of NaOH = 0.1237 L

Cb = (2*0.01712*0.250)/0.1237

Cb = 0.0691 M

The molarity of the sodium hydroxide solution is 0.0692 M

Explain the composition of dna nucleotides and the structure of the dna molecule need help
Kaylis [27]

A nucleotide is composed of a phosphate group, sugar, and nitrogen base. DNA is made of 2 strands of nucleotides linked together by covalent bonds between the phosphate and sugar of each nucleotide. The strands of nucleotides are linked together by hydrogen bonds creating DNA. Hope this helps and sorry if I made a mistake.
